Many hands make light work

‘’A thriving metropolis at the bottom of 15th Ave’’ is how many describe Good Neighbour; they are not wrong.

Our dedicated team of 140 food rescue volunteers who receive and sort food from supermarkets, distributors, local markets, and cafes, have distributed a whopping 147,377kgs to 70 charities over the past quarter: an average of 49,000kgs per month. This food is good enough to eat, but not good enough to sell.

Our wonderful volunteers, their many hands, and beautiful hearts contribute to supporting, on average 5,000 people weekly with rescued food. The team here at Good Neighbour is humbled by the time, effort, and commitment from each volunteer, in ensuring the well-being of our community.
